Microsoft has published CVE-2026-40377, a critical elevation-of-privilege vulnerability in Windows Cryptographic Services, in its Security Update Guide on May 12, 2026. The advisory includes a new Report Confidence metric designed to help IT teams prioritize patching. This vulnerability, rooted in the core cryptography stack, could allow attackers to gain SYSTEM-level access on unpatched machines. Organizations are urged to evaluate the risk using Microsoft’s confidence scoring and apply the fix immediately.

Windows Cryptographic Services, often abbreviated as CryptSvc, manages certificate and key operations across the OS. It underpins everything from TLS connections to code signing and BitLocker encryption. When an attacker elevates privileges through this service, they effectively bypass one of the strongest security boundaries in Windows. CVE-2026-40377 specifically targets a flaw in how CryptSvc handles certain cryptographic operations, enabling a local, authenticated attacker to execute arbitrary code with elevated permissions.

Microsoft’s advisory does not detail the technical exploit mechanism, as is standard until patches are widely deployed. However, historical trends in CryptoAPI vulnerabilities suggest common vectors: buffer overflows in certificate parsing, integer overflows in key generation, or logic flaws in object serialization. Regardless of the root cause, the impact is severe. A successful exploit could allow an attacker to decrypt protected data, sign malicious code with trusted certificates, or disable security features like Secure Boot.

The vulnerability affects all supported Windows editions—client and server—including Windows 10, Windows 11, Windows Server 2019, and Windows Server 2022 as of the disclosure date. Microsoft has released a security update that patches the issue, and the patch appears in the May 2026 Patch Tuesday release.

Report Confidence: A New Triage Metric

What sets CVE-2026-40377 apart is its inclusion in Microsoft’s expanded vulnerability metadata. The Security Update Guide now displays a “Report Confidence” field, reflecting how strongly Microsoft believes the vulnerability is exploitable based on the report’s quality and internal reproduction efforts. For CVE-2026-40377, the confidence score is marked as “High,” meaning the report came from a credible source, details were reproducible, and the exploit code likely works consistently.

This metric matters. Over the past three years, Microsoft has refined its vulnerability disclosure framework to help overstretched security teams cut through the noise. With dozens of CVEs each month, not all pose equal risk. Report Confidence joins exploitability assessments (Exploitability Index) and severity scores (CVSS) to form a three-dimensional risk picture. A high-confidence CVE, especially one categorized as Elevation of Privilege, often indicates that exploit code is already circulating or that public proof-of-concept code is imminent. Security analysts should treat a “High” confidence designation as a call to action, even if no active attacks are known.

For CVE-2026-40377, the combination of high confidence, a CVSS v3.1 base score of 7.8 (Important), and its presence in a foundational service means the risk is acute. While an authenticated, local attack vector is required, the barrier is low—many enterprises face risks from compromised user accounts, insider threats, or attackers who have already achieved initial footholds via phishing or other means.

Cryptographic Elevation of Privilege: Why It’s Dangerous

Elevation-of-privilege (EoP) bugs in cryptographic components are particularly insidious. Unlike a run-of-the-mill EoP in a user-space process, a CryptoAPI flaw can grant an attacker the ability to impersonate any user, tamper with system integrity checks, or decrypt sensitive material. Consider three real-world attack scenarios:

  • Ransomware escalation: Attackers who first gain access as a standard user could exploit CVE-2026-40377 to disable endpoint encryption or tamper with backup certificates, making recovery impossible without paying the ransom.
  • Supply chain poisoning: A malicious insider or compromised developer account could sign malware with a legitimate certificate derived from the local machine, bypassing code-signing checks like SmartScreen.
  • Credential theft: By elevating to SYSTEM, an attacker can dump LSASS credentials or modify authentication protocols, moving laterally across the network.

Because CryptSvc loads early in the boot sequence and runs in a privileged context, exploiting it can also persist across reboots, evading many detection tools that scan user-mode processes.

The Patch and Affected Components

Microsoft addressed the vulnerability in security update KB5036626 for Windows 11 version 23H2, KB5036625 for Windows 10 22H2, and corresponding updates for Windows Server. The fix modifies how the cryptographic service validates object lengths and handles memory allocation during specific API calls. The patch is cumulative, so organizations that apply the latest monthly rollup are protected.

IT administrators must verify that all systems receive the update. Workstations, servers, and even virtual desktop infrastructure hosts are in scope. Microsoft recommends applying patches within 24 hours for high-confidence, high-severity vulnerabilities when an Exploitability Index rating of “1” or higher is present. For CVE-2026-40377, the Exploitability Index is rated “1” (Exploitation More Likely), reinforcing the need for rapid action.

How Attackers Could Exploit CVE-2026-40377

Although no in-the-wild exploitation has been reported as of the disclosure date, the high report confidence suggests that a functional exploit exists. Typically, an attacker would need to:

  1. Obtain local access to the target system, either through a compromised user account or physical access.
  2. Run a specially crafted binary that invokes a vulnerable cryptographic function—likely related to certificate enrollment or key storage.
  3. Trigger a memory corruption or logic flaw that grants SYSTEM privileges.
  4. Execute malicious actions, such as installing a rootkit or exfiltrating credentials.

The attack surface includes any application or service that interacts with the CryptoAPI. Remote desktop services, web servers performing SSL/TLS, and custom line-of-business apps that use Windows Certificate Store are all potential avenues if the attacker can inject code into those processes.

Mitigations and Workarounds

Before the patch is deployed, Microsoft suggests limiting access to the cryptographic services by enforcing strict user permissions. However, no practical workaround exists because the flaw lies within a core system service. Standard advice includes:

  • Ensure all users operate with least privilege; remove local administrator rights where possible.
  • Monitor for suspicious use of cryptographic functions via Sysmon or Windows Event Log (Event IDs 5068, 5058, 5061).
  • Apply attack surface reduction rules in Microsoft Defender that block suspicious process behavior from common entry points.
  • Disable unnecessary cryptographic services on devices that do not require them, though this may break critical functionality.

Once patched, organizations should verify the fix by checking the file version of crypt32.dll, which should match the update build. Automated tools like Nessus, Qualys, or Microsoft’s own Compliance Toolkit can confirm patch status.

Incorporating Report Confidence into Your Workflow

The introduction of Report Confidence marks a shift toward more transparent vulnerability management. Security teams can now build automated playbooks that prioritize patches based on the sum:

Priority Score = (CVSS * Age) + (Report Confidence * Exploitability Index)

Assign numeric weights to confidence levels: High = 10, Medium = 5, Low = 1. Multiply by Microsoft’s Exploitability Index (1 = more likely, 2 = less likely, etc.) to get a risk multiplier. This mathematical approach ensures that subjective judgments don’t delay critical fixes.

For CVE-2026-40377, with High confidence and Exploitability Index 1, the combined score would vault it to the top of the patch queue. Combined with the fact that cryptographic components rarely get frequent patches, the urgency intensifies.

Looking Ahead: The New Normal in CVE Risk Assessment

Microsoft’s experiment with Report Confidence is part of a broader industry trend. The Common Vulnerability Scoring System v4.0, released in late 2024, introduced “Suppressed” metrics that allow vendors to convey low confidence in a report. Microsoft’s approach is more granular and directly actionable. As AI-assisted vulnerability discovery grows, confidence metrics will become indispensable—not every AI-generated report is correct, and humans must triage.

CVE-2026-40377 may be one of the first major tests of this new rating. If the vulnerability leads to widespread attacks, the community will scrutinize whether “High-confidence” lived up to its name. Conversely, if it fizzles, skeptics may question the metric’s utility. Either way, for the overworked CISO, any guidance that cuts through the alert fatigue is welcome.

Key Takeaways for Windows Security Practitioners

  • Patch immediately: Microsoft has rated CVE-2026-40377 as Exploitation More Likely with High report confidence. The patch is available in the May 2026 Patch Tuesday updates.
  • Audit cryptographic usage: Map all business applications that rely on Windows Cryptographic Services to understand potential blast radius.
  • Leverage report confidence: Integrate the new metric into your vulnerability prioritization policy, alongside CVSS and internal asset criticality.
  • Monitor post-patch: After deployment, watch for any unexpected behavior in certificate services or authentication; patches for EoP bugs can rarely cause compatibility issues with legacy crypto drivers.

The cybersecurity landscape doesn’t slow down. CVE-2026-40377 is a stark reminder that even operating system foundations can betray you. With high-confidence ratings and clear exploitation vectors, this isn’t one to push to next month’s maintenance window.